No offense ODM, but someone's double secret anonymous posts don't hold a lot of credence.

I read those posts, btw, and the woman is vascillating all over the place. First she said that CBS is concerned about what NBC is doing. Then she's saying that Les isn't concerned at all and could kick Zucker's a$$. Maybe TR will be held back for mid-season. Maybe TR and even another med drama will be on the schedule to show NBC how it's done. And then there's the part about TR being presented at upfronts like it's some sort of bidding war for advertisers to decide which show is picked up. Sorry, that's not the way it works. The network will present its schedule and present which shows that HAVE picked up to the press and to give a preview for potential advertisers.

Let's face it, at this point it's a crapshoot. And if I want to be concerned with speculation, I'll stick to the more legit sources.
